| Automated Radar Signal Simulator General
Description
The Automated Radar Signal Simulator system provides automatic
end-to-end testing of Electronic Warfare/Combat (EW/EC)) receiver
systems. The ARSS combines the AN/PLM-4
Radar Signal Simulator (RSS),
which provides System-Under-Test (SUT) Radio Frequency (RF) stimulus,
and the Advanced
Diagnostic Software (ADS) System PC as the SUT monitoring
device.
The ADS PC connects directly to the SUT MIL-STD-1553B data bus
and contains the software to decode the MIL-STD-1553B messages from
the SUT and display the results to the operator in a Windows style
Graphical User Interface (GUI). Typical SUT data presented to the
operator includes
Frequency
Pulse Repetition Interval (PRI)
Pulse Width (PW)
Signal Amplitude
Signal Identification
In addition, the ADS PC monitors the SUT Built-In-Test (BIT) messages,
decodes and displays them to the operator in a real-time display.
The real-time BIT monitor eliminates the need for downloading SUT
data to a remote ground processor for analysis. In addition to low
cost, SUT end-to-end testing with the ADS PC provides the benefit
of an expert maintenance advisor linked directly to the SUT bus
monitor for extensive and effective real-time SUT diagnostics solutions.

Automated
RSS Capabilities
 |
0.5 to 18.0 GHz frequency coverage with options
to 40 GHz |
 |
All emitter parameters are operator programmable from front
panel, or remote terminal |
 |
Lightweight and small size allows easy direction testing |
 |
Built-In battery charger |
